Output d24d3eabe6e23125a980e78ca9a571ef9ccfb923116541e5a118a1c435258a60:4

value
45246557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aff4aaee46d4c2f9ed7034084fbc84daa2a420b OP_EQUAL
address
3EMxzzmVAkWXPWRw3s284carCjkdfAWiHh
transaction
d24d3eabe6e23125a980e78ca9a571ef9ccfb923116541e5a118a1c435258a60
spent
true